What is Delek US Holdings Debt-to-Equity?

Delek US Holdings DK -0.39% 48 Debt-to-Equity is 17.45 as of Jun. 2026, which is 571% above its 10-year median of 2.60. GuruFocus rates DK with a GF Score™ of 48/100 and a GF Value™ of $22.00 (Significantly Overvalued). The stock has 5 warning signs investors should review. Among 804 Oil & Gas companies, Delek US Holdings ranks worse than 99.88% on this metric.

Delek US Holdings's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was $36 Mil. Delek US Holdings's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was $3,220 Mil. Delek US Holdings's Total Stockholders Equity for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was $187 Mil. Delek US Holdings's debt to equity for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was 17.45.

A high debt to equity ratio generally means that a company has been aggressive in financing its growth with debt. This can result in volatile earnings as a result of the additional interest expense.

Delek US Holdings  (NYSE:DK) Debt-to-Equity Explanation

In the calculation of Debt to Equity, we use the total of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ation divided by Total Stockholders Equity. In some calculations, Total Liabilities is used to for calculation.


Be Aware

Because a company can increase its ROE % by having more financial leverage, it is important to watch the leverage ratio when investing in high ROE % companies.

Delek US Holdings Business Description

Industry EnergyOil & Gas
Other Exchanges DEH:Germany
Address 310 Seven Springs Way, Suite 500, Brentwood, TN, USA, 37027
Delek US Holdings Inc is an integrated energy business focused on petroleum refining, transportation and storage; wholesale crude oil, intermediate, and refined products, and convenience stores retailing. The company owns and operates independent refineries that produce a variety of petroleum products for transportation and industrial markets in the United States. It has three segments: Refining segment and Logistics segment and retail segment. The logistics segment generates revenue through gathering, transporting, and storing crude oil and intermediate products, as well as by marketing, storing, and distributing refined products. The company also offers a collection of retail fuel and convenience stores operating in the Southeast region of the United States.
